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,324,090,404
Lastest Block:
1,960,886
Utxos:
1,983,747
Nodes:
346
OmniXEP Contracts:
274
Block detail
[STAKE]
22/04/2025 06:33:52 UTC
Txid
4de5f6f3fdaca1da18babe690e6561d4909373fd88dda09efa1fe7634b4b970d
Block
1,703,848
Block hash
23c4e4f3911ed42fa0d66b3088ff6aacccf54b691348898d7071628f96bcec09
Stake amount
239.19313365 XEP
Sender
ep1q0gstl5ljykz77qf0w9gwg4g0v56frct6uzfwn7
Recipient
ep1q0c0psqkghx89e95sz7frn80xwwtlpa3wylsert
(5,235,069.47955219 XEP)